Jonathan Silvertown – Genes, Egoism and the Power of Cooperation: Evolution as a Team Game

In a world often defined by competition for resources, it’s easy to see individualism as the engine of progress. Yet evolutionary biologist Jonathan Silvertown argues that cooperation, not selfishness, has driven life forward for 4 billion years. Drawing on surprising examples—from the behavior of rats and crows, to the structure of earthworms and lichens, to pirate codes and charitable organizations—Silvertown shows that every creature, including humans, is wired to collaborate in its own interest. There is no contradiction: joining forces for mutual benefit and risk prevention sparked life itself and shaped evolution. Our tendency to help each other is rooted in a biological law that drives cooperation. Meanwhile, senseless violence, the author contends, is the greatest challenge to human survival as a species.
